** The window service market for Turnersburg and the greater Surry County area is characterized by a mix of established local contractors and regional franchise operators. Due to the rural nature of the community, there are no "big-box" installers physically located within it; residents rely on providers from nearby hubs like Mount Airy (the county seat) and Dobson. The competition is moderate but healthy, ensuring several quality options for homeowners. The average quality of service is high, with contractors being well-versed in the specific needs of homes in the region, including improving energy efficiency for older properties and providing durable solutions. Typical pricing for a standard vinyl double-hung window replacement can range from **$450 to $850 per window**, including installation. This price can increase significantly for high-end, custom, or specialty windows (e.g., bay windows, wood clad, impact-resistant). Most reputable providers offer free, in-home estimates and consultations.

For a standard-sized home in Turnersburg, a full window replacement typically ranges from $8,000 to $20,000, depending on the number of windows, materials (vinyl, wood, fiberglass), and energy efficiency features. Local pricing is influenced by regional labor costs and the specific energy needs of our Piedmont climate, which features hot, humid summers and occasional cold snaps, making quality installation for thermal performance a key cost factor.

Late spring (April-May) and early fall (September-October) are ideal in Turnersburg, as these periods typically offer mild, dry weather that facilitates proper sealing and curing of materials. Avoiding the peak humidity of summer and the occasional winter ice storms common in the Piedmont region helps ensure a smoother installation process and allows for proper ventilation if new seals or paints are used.

For Turnersburg's climate, look for windows with a low U-factor (for winter heat retention) and a low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) to block significant summer heat gain. Double-pane Low-E argon gas-filled windows are highly recommended as they effectively manage both the summer humidity/heat and our colder winter periods, directly impacting your year-round comfort and utility bills from providers like EnergyUnited or Piedmont Electric.
